[CSS] div mit dynamischer breite zentrieren

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• [CSS] div mit dynamischer breite zentrieren

    Ich habe einen Div-Container, den ich dynamisch mit einer unterschiedlichen anzahl von Bildern füllen muss. Ich möchte aber, dass er trotz der unbekannten breite zentiert wird.
    Wie stelle ich das an?
    Bis jetzt konnte ich wirklich keine Lösung finden. Außer ich gebe eine feste Breite an, aber dies hilt mir nicht weiter...

    Eine andere Lösung, die funktioniert, wäre, einfach display:table; anzugeben, doch das kennt der IE nicht und bei Opera spielt die Bilder-Auflistung verrückt
    Zuletzt geändert von Maranello-550; 20.05.2008, 22:30.
    arrays sind klasse

  • #2
    Dir scheint das verhalten eines Block Level Elements nicht klar zu sein oder ?

    Block Level Elemente nehmen Immer ihre volle Breite ein.
    Außer man sagt ihnen sei kleiner als der Platz der dir zur Verfügung steht.

    Code:
    <div class="CenterMe">
    ich Stehe in der Mitte
    </div>
    CSS dazu

    Code:
    .CenterMe
    {
    margin-left:auto;
    margin-right:auto;
    border:1px solid black;
    }
    Du siehst anhand dieses Beispieles Das das Div 100% Breit ist ...
    Wenn ich diesem jetzt sagen wir mal eine Breite von 500px geben Sitzt es mittig.

    Das heist du musst entweder irgendwie die Breiten aller Inhalte innerhalb des Div ermitteln. Oder ihm eine feste Breite geben und alles was darin ist auf diese Breite beschränken.
    Bitte Beachten.
    Foren-Regeln
    Danke

    Kommentar

    Lädt...
    X